Dr. Bianca Ramalho Quintaes
Dr. Bianca Ramalho Quintaes
Municipal Cleaning Company of Rio de Janeiro, Brazil

Dr. Bianca Ramalho Quintaes is a biologist and researcher specializing in urban sustainability, food waste, and circular economy strategies. She holds a Ph.D. in Chemical and Biochemical Processes from the Federal University of Rio de Janeiro (UFRJ) and a Master’s degree in Medical Microbiology from the State University of Rio de Janeiro (UERJ). She serves as Department Manager at the Applied Research Center of COMLURB, Rio de Janeiro’s Municipal Urban Cleaning Company, where she leads applied research integrating science, public policy, and urban environmental management. Her work focuses on household solid waste analysis, food waste assessment, composting systems, and innovative pathways for food recovery within circular economy frameworks. Dr. Quintaes has extensive experience in microbiological analysis of environmental samples, landfill leachate studies, and sanitation quality control. Her current work bridges waste management and food systems, promoting evidence-based solutions to reduce waste while supporting sustainable food production in urban environments.

Title of talk: Food Waste in Household Solid Waste: Evidence from Rio de Janeiro’s Waste Survey and Circular Pathways for Food Recovery
